First-Line Supervisors of Non-Retail Sales Workers in Iowa

Considering working as a First-Line Supervisors of Non-Retail Sales Workers in Iowa? Here’s what you need to know. Directly supervise and coordinate activities of sales workers other than retail sales workers. May perform duties such as budgeting, accounting, and personnel work, in addition to supervisory duties.

What do First-Line Supervisors of Non-Retail Sales Workers Make in Iowa?

For a first-line supervisors of non-retail sales workers working in Iowa, the typical annual salary is $83,520 per year (or roughly $40.15/hour).Annual wages span from $45,580 at the 10th percentile to $157,620 at the 90th percentile.

Wage Statistic Annual Hourly
10th percentile $45,580 $21.91
25th percentile $61,440 $29.54
Median (50th) $83,520 $40.15
75th percentile $107,690 $51.77
90th percentile $157,620 $75.78

Daily Tasks

Common tasks include:

  • Monitor sales staff performance to ensure that goals are met.
  • Provide staff with assistance in performing difficult or complicated duties.
  • Direct and supervise employees engaged in sales, inventory-taking, reconciling cash receipts, or performing specific services.
  • Listen to and resolve customer complaints regarding services, products, or personnel.
  • Keep records pertaining to purchases, sales, and requisitions.
  • Hire, train, and evaluate personnel.
  • Confer with company officials to develop methods and procedures to increase sales, expand markets, and promote business.
  • Plan and prepare work schedules, and assign employees to specific duties.
  • Attend company meetings to exchange product information and coordinate work activities with other departments.
  • Visit retailers and sales representatives to promote products and gather information.
  • Formulate pricing policies on merchandise according to profitability requirements.
  • Prepare sales and inventory reports for management and budget departments.
